I saw a few things tonight. First, the Cowboys OL run blocks better than they pass block. As long as the game is close the Cowboys should run the football. When Dak gets back they should still run the football and set up the play action passes downfield.

I thought Tyler Smith had maybe his worst game this year. He struggles pass blocking quicker DEs. I thought tonight the Cowboys missed Tyron Smith. McGovern had some issues too, I think if Tyron was playing LT and Tyler LG, the Cowboys offensive line would have given Rush more time to throw. But this is what injuries do. Eventually they show up.

The Eagles found a way to keep Parsons out of the backfield all night. It seemed like he was in coverage a lot. He looked a little lost at times. Quinn needs to jump on that.

The Cowboys offense is not good enough to overcome 3 turnovers unless the defense takes the ball away a few times. I think Rush has run his course.

The Eagles had only 10 penalty yards tonight. The Cowboys had 72. What you put that together with 3 INTs is spells LOSS. Some of the penalties were just dumb.

This was a big loss because the Eagles have an easy schedule this year. I think they will win the division although it is a long season and injuries can change a lot. But Dallas will make the playoffs because the NFC is a disaster. The Eagles will not beat the Cowboys 3 times, I guarantee it.

With Dak back I think the Cowboys will score more than 20 points a game, probably more than 25. This will take some of the pressure off the defense.

The Cowboys LBs were good tonight. LVE may have played his best game all season.

The Eagles averaged only 3.9 yards per play tonight and 3.5 yards per carry. The Cowboys average 4.9 and 5.2. I think the Cowboys defense is for real. But as I said before the game, if the Eagles got a big lead Rush would not be good enough to make a comeback. He got some points in the second half but he gave up way too much.
